What Does a Casino License Actually Do?

A casino license isn’t just a piece of paper; it’s a guarantee of certain standards. Here’s what it means for you, the player:

  • Fair Games: Licensed casinos use Random Number Generators (RNGs) to ensure that games are truly random and unbiased. This means every spin of the slots and every deal of the cards is fair.
  • Player Protection: Licensed casinos are obligated to protect your personal and financial information using secure encryption technology. They must also have procedures in place to prevent fraud and money laundering.
  • Responsible Gambling: Licensed casinos promote responsible gambling. They offer tools like deposit limits, self-exclusion options, and links to support organizations for those who may be struggling with gambling addiction.
  • Payment Security: Licensed casinos use secure payment methods for both deposits and withdrawals, ensuring your transactions are safe and protected.
  • Dispute Resolution: In case of any issues, licensed casinos have clear procedures for handling complaints and resolving disputes. The licensing authority will often act as a mediator.

In essence, a license provides a safety net, ensuring a more trustworthy and enjoyable gaming experience.

How to Check a Casino’s License

Checking a casino’s license is easier than you might think. Here’s how to do it:

  1. Find the Information: Licensed casinos proudly display their license information on their website. Look for it in the footer (at the bottom of the page), often near the terms and conditions or privacy policy. You should see the name of the licensing authority (e.g., the Szerencsejáték Felügyelet for Hungarian licenses) and a license number.
  2. Verify the License: Once you have the license information, go to the website of the licensing authority. Most authorities have a database or a section where you can search for licensed casinos. Enter the casino’s name or license number to verify that it’s legitimate.
  3. Check the Details: Pay attention to the details. Make sure the license is valid (not expired) and that it covers the type of games you want to play. Some licenses are specific to certain types of games.
  4. Be Wary of Suspicious Sites: If you can’t find any license information, or if the information seems vague or untrustworthy, it’s best to avoid that casino. Similarly, be cautious of casinos that claim to be licensed by authorities you’ve never heard of.

Key Licensing Authorities to Know

When gambling online in Hungary, it’s essential to familiarize yourself with the main licensing authority. Here’s the most important one:

  • Szerencsejáték Felügyelet (Hungarian Gambling Supervisory Authority): This is the primary regulatory body for online gambling in Hungary. If a casino is licensed by the Szerencsejáték Felügyelet, it means it has been vetted and approved to operate legally within Hungary. Always prioritize casinos licensed by this authority.

Keep in mind that some casinos might also hold licenses from other reputable jurisdictions, such as the Malta Gaming Authority (MGA) or the UK Gambling Commission (UKGC). While these licenses are generally trustworthy, it’s always a good idea to prioritize licenses that specifically cover Hungary.

Red Flags to Watch Out For

Even with a license, there are some warning signs that might indicate a casino isn’t entirely trustworthy. Be aware of these red flags:

  • Poor Customer Service: If a casino has slow or unresponsive customer support, it could be a sign of problems.
  • Unclear Terms and Conditions: Vague or confusing terms and conditions can be a way for a casino to take advantage of you. Always read the fine print.
  • Unrealistic Bonuses: Be wary of bonuses that seem too good to be true. They often come with difficult-to-meet wagering requirements.
  • Negative Reviews: Check online reviews and forums to see what other players are saying about the casino.
  • Limited Payment Options: A reputable casino should offer a variety of secure payment methods.
  • Lack of Transparency: If a casino is secretive about its ownership or its games, it’s best to steer clear.

Trust your instincts. If something feels off, it probably is.
